Morsston
Morsston is a hamlet in Town of Rockland, Sullivan County, New York. Morsston is situated nearby to the village Livingston Manor, as well as near the hamlet Parkston.Places of Interest

Van Tran Flat Bridge

The Van Tran Flat Bridge is a wooden, single span covered bridge that crosses Willowemoc Creek in the town of Rockland, in Sullivan County, New York. The bridge was built in 1860 by John Davidson and features a town lattice truss and a laminated arch system. Van Tran Flat Bridge is situated 2½ miles northwest of Morsston.

Livingston Manor

Livingston Manor is a hamlet in Sullivan County, New York, United States. The population was 1,053 at the 2020 census. Livingston Manor is located in the southern part of the town of Rockland. New York State Route 17 runs by it.
Parksville

Parksville is a small hamlet in the town of Liberty, Sullivan County, New York, United States. The ZIP Code is 12768. It is situated at exit 98 on Route 17. Parksville is situated 3½ miles southeast of Morsston.
Debruce

De Bruce is a small hamlet located in Sullivan County, New York, United States. Debruce is situated 4½ miles northeast of Morsston.
